Root Ports

Explain the succession of events:

  1. SW2 becomes the root as it is the one with the lowest priority. Because of this, all its ports are designated ports.

  2. SW1 and SW4 are both directly connected to SW2, via G0/0 and G0/1 respectively, so these ports become root ports.

  3. For SW3, the cost (gigabit connections) is the same for both connections so it looks for the neighbor with the lowest bridge ID. This is SW1 because, although the priorities between SW1 and SW4 are the same, SW1's MAC address is lower.
